AT89LV51-12PC belongs to the category of microcontrollers.
This microcontroller is commonly used in various electronic applications that require a programmable device to control and monitor different functions.
AT89LV51-12PC is available in a 40-pin DIP (Dual Inline Package) format.

AT89LV51-12PC operates based on the principles of a microcontroller. It executes instructions stored in its flash memory, interacts with external devices through I/O lines, and utilizes timers/counters for precise timing and event handling. The microcontroller can be programmed using various development tools and languages to perform specific tasks as required by the application.
